Allan Lyckegaard is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Radiation and Mechanical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Allan Lyckegaard has authored 16 papers receiving a total of 397 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Materials Chemistry, 5 papers in Radiation and 4 papers in Mechanical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Allan Lyckegaard’s work include Advanced X-ray Imaging Techniques (5 papers), Microstructure and mechanical properties (3 papers) and Analysis of Traffic Safety and Driver Behavior (3 papers). Allan Lyckegaard is often cited by papers focused on Advanced X-ray Imaging Techniques (5 papers), Microstructure and mechanical properties (3 papers) and Analysis of Traffic Safety and Driver Behavior (3 papers). Allan Lyckegaard collaborates with scholars based in Denmark, France and United States. Allan Lyckegaard's co-authors include Tove Hels, E.M. Lauridsen, Inger Marie Bernhoft, Paul Tafforeau, Henning Friis Poulsen, Dorte Juul Jensen, R. W. Fonda, Wolfgang Ludwig, Kirsten Wiese Simonsen and Anni Steentoft and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Materials Science, Scripta Materialia and Accident Analysis & Prevention.
